id: 'params' | 'description' | 'reviews'
};
const [selected, setSelected] = useState<>('params');
const tabs: Tab[] = [
{title: 'Параметры', id: 'params'},
{title: 'Описание', id: 'description'},
{title: 'Отзывы', id: 'reviews'}
];
Как сделать чтоб тип у стейта selected был равен типу парметра id у типа Tab?
type ID = 'params' | 'description' | 'reviews' type Tab = { title: string, id: ID }; const [selected, setSelected] = useState<ID>('params');
Обсуждают сегодня